Overwork by the traffic police and law enforcement to manage the large crowd at the Marracash concert at the Agnano racecourse in Naples.
An estimated 55 spectators attended the 'Marrageddon' show. The Naples local police deployed 120 officers and six officials to ensure safety and law enforcement. During the event, six seizures of counterfeit merchandise were made, including merchandise, T-shirts, headbands, and hats.
Counterfeit material also seized
Five drinks were also seized.

But it wasn't just Marracash who was targeted. The local police also managed the city's nightlife in the Chiaia area and carried out checks in the area, with 15 fines for violations of the highway code.
Checks were also carried out in the hilly area of the Vomero and Arenella neighborhoods, resulting in 12 fines. Two public establishments were fined for playing unauthorized music. One establishment was fined for selling alcohol after midnight, and another for improper waste management.
